I'm trying to upgrade my Windows ME to Windows XP home edition, using upgrade
CD and an error message comes up saying the language differs from the one i'm
installing and an upgrade will not be available, and that upgrade
functionality is disabled, what can i do to allow upgrade???

The language of the ME system is (fill in the blank)?
The language of the XP upgrade is (fill in the blank)?

These have to be the same and obviously they are not, that
is what the error message is telling you.

To fix the problem you must do either one of these steps...
return the upgrade CD for exchange for one with the same
language as the ME installation; or
buy a new retail full install and either do a clean install
or setup a dual boot (if you have enough disk space and a
program such as Partition Magic to create a partition.
If you choose to do a clean install, you can buy a MS OEM XP
CD which will need to be installed on a formatted drive
without an OS present. You could try booting your ME
machine from a floppy and deleting the Windows directory,
leaving your data intact. But no matter what procedure you
follow, backup your data before you begin.
